Handover: Alert Dedupe Service (Brindlewick team). Before you review PR 217, context: the deduplicator collapses paging alerts by fingerprint within a sliding 90-second window. I changed the hash to include severity, which fixed the flapping-host storm but broke two fixtures — both updated. Watch the idempotency guard in merge_window(); it's subtle and easy to regress. Config lives in the Tallowgate vault, which re-sealed after the deploy. To reopen it and run the integration suite, you'll need the recovery passphrase below.

recovery phrase for fajep-yaweg: gilath-sorox-wenius-rusdor-keliel-zorius

## Runbook: Gridmint export memory pressure

Large spreadsheet exports in Gridmint can balloon worker memory when a tenant requests more than roughly 200k rows, because the renderer buffers whole sheets before streaming. If you see OOM kills on the export workers, first confirm the streaming-chunk mode is enabled and the row cap hasn't been raised manually. Restarting workers clears pressure but not the cause. Verify the running values against the expected configuration below.

deployment values, yadug-bawif:
[framir]
team = pelox
access_code = ac_a38ab2
owner = tamion.julael
host = framir.tolvaqlabs.test
port = 11211
peer = tammir.zemvargrid.local
salt = 2215ef03
pin = 1541

Release checklist — Partner SFTP drop

Before sign-off: confirm the Varrow Logistics SFTP drop completed for the nightly manifest. Check the landing folder under /incoming/varrow, verify file count matches the manifest header, and confirm checksums pass. If anything is missing, page the integrations on-call; do not re-trigger manually. Once verified, record the drop against the build noted below.

build token for yajof-bajof: htk31_506ff1188f74596b5bb2eec94edc43c